Energy efficiency testing

Energy efficiency requirements

UL can evaluate and test HVAC/R equipment to mandated U.S. Department of Energy (DOE), California Energy Commission (CEC), National Resources Canada (NRCan) and other international or regional requirements, UL, ASHRAE, AHRI and international standards, or to customer-specific energy efficiency requirements. UL is also an EPA-recognized Certification Body (CB) for the ENERGY STAR® Program. For more information on how UL can assist you with the enhanced requirements, click here.

State-of-the-art facility

UL's Dallas Energy Efficiency Test Center opened in 2005 and is one of the largest HVAC/R performance testing facilities in North America. The center underwent an extensive expansion in 2009 that doubled UL's HVAC/R performance testing capacity and enhanced its industry service capabilities.

Facility features

The 33,000 square foot facility features state-of-the-art equipment and comprehensive capabilities for energy efficiency testing for a variety of HVAC/R product categories including both split and packaged small and large unitary equipment, water source air conditioning and heat pump equipment, unit ventilators, single package vertical air conditioners, unitary spot coolers, chillers, DX coils, water coils and steam coils, unit fan coils, packaged terminal heat pumps, household refrigerators, commercial icemakers, both self-contained and remote commercial refrigerated display merchandisers and variable refrigerant flow multi-split equipment.

  • Seven dual-cell psychrometric testing chambers
  • HVAC capacity to test air-cooled/water-cooled units up to 30 tons
  • Equipped to handle international or domestic units that run at 50 or 60 Hz
  • Temperature-controlled chambers from -10ºF to 132ºF
  • Airflow measurements up to 15,000 CFM
  • Water flow rate from 0 to 3,000 lbs per minute
  • Refrigerant flow rate from 0 to 250 lbs per minute
  • More than 200 thermocouple points per chamber
  • Specialized and high accuracy transducers for power, voltage, amps, and pressures
  • Data collect speeds up to once per second
  • Remote data tracking capability through online connections and in real-time
  • Grade-level and dock-height doors for easy loading and unloading of equipment

UL advantage

Bundled safety testing

UL can perform safety certification testing on products at the same location energy efficiency testing is performed, improving operational efficiencies to help achieve your time-to-market requirements.

Flexible component testing options

UL can help determine which components optimize the energy efficiency of a product. Several components from the product manufacturer or component manufacturers can be sent directly to UL for comparison testing.

Convenient data tracking

You can take advantage of faster troubleshooting at our state-of-the-art testing facilities designed to provide best-in-class test data. Real-time test data can also be viewed live by engineers anywhere in the world through our online data tracking software.

Expert staff

Our knowledgeable team of HVAC/R engineering professionals has a wealth of experience in assisting manufacturers with compliance to performance and safety requirements.
